Technological Development of Square Lithium - Ion Batteries

  Square lithium - ion batteries have witnessed significant technological advancements in recent years. One of the key areas of development is in the improvement of energy density. Researchers and manufacturers are constantly exploring new materials for electrodes. For the cathode, the development of high - nickel cathode materials, such as nickel - manganese - cobalt (NMC) and nickel - cobalt - aluminum (NCA) oxides with higher nickel content, has shown great promise. These materials can store more lithium ions, leading to an increase in the battery's energy density. For example, some advanced square lithium - ion batteries with high - nickel cathodes can achieve an energy density of over 300 Wh/kg, which is much higher than the earlier - generation batteries.

  On the anode side, the use of silicon - based materials is emerging as a game - changer. Silicon has a much higher theoretical lithium - storage capacity compared to traditional graphite anodes. However, challenges such as significant volume expansion during charging and discharging have been a hurdle. Through the development of composite silicon - graphite anodes and advanced nanostructured silicon materials, these issues are being addressed. By combining silicon with graphite, the overall lithium - storage capacity of the anode can be increased while maintaining the structural integrity of the electrode, thereby enhancing the energy density of the square lithium - ion battery.

  Another important aspect of technological development is in improving the battery's cycle life. New electrolyte formulations are being developed to reduce the formation of solid - electrolyte interphase (SEI) layers that can cause capacity fade over time. Additives in the electrolyte can help to stabilize the SEI layer, prevent its continuous growth, and thus extend the battery's cycle life. Additionally, advancements in battery management systems (BMS) are crucial. BMS can precisely monitor the state of charge, state of health, and temperature of the square lithium - ion battery. By accurately controlling the charging and discharging processes based on this information, the battery can be operated within optimal conditions, further improving its cycle life.

  In terms of manufacturing technology, there have been efforts to make the production of square lithium - ion batteries more efficient and cost - effective. Automated manufacturing processes with high - precision equipment are being adopted to ensure consistent quality. For example, roll - to - roll manufacturing techniques are being refined for the production of electrode foils, which can significantly increase production speed and reduce manufacturing costs.
